Visual c++ EclipseVC++;

Visual c++ EclipseVC++;,visual-c++,eclipse-cdt,sfml,Visual C++,Eclipse Cdt,Sfml,我正在尝试在我的项目中使用该库进行音频 我在Eclipse朱诺中开发C++,AM使用SFML V1.6. 我将sfml-audio-d.lib、sfml-main-d.lib和sfml-system-d.lib添加到 C/C++常规>路径和符号>库 我还定义了一个名为SFML_DYNAMIC into的宏 C/C++编译>设置>C++编译器>预处理器定义/D”部分 我将包含所有DLL的目录添加到PATH环境变量中 在我的代码中,我使用了sf::SoundBuffer,但是当我尝试构建项目时,我得

我正在尝试在我的项目中使用该库进行音频

我在Eclipse朱诺中开发C++,AM使用SFML V1.6. 我将

sfml-audio-d.lib
sfml-main-d.lib
sfml-system-d.lib
添加到

C/C++常规>路径和符号>库

我还定义了一个名为SFML_DYNAMIC into的宏

C/C++编译>设置>C++编译器>预处理器
定义/D”部分

我将包含所有DLL的目录添加到PATH环境变量中

在我的代码中,我使用了sf::SoundBuffer,但是当我尝试构建项目时,我得到了以下链接器错误:

Chunk.obj:错误LNK2001:未解析的外部符号“private:静态类sf::SoundBuffer*Chunk::breakBlockSound”(?breakBlockSound@Chunk@@0PAVSoundBuffer@sf@@(A)

MyProject.exe:致命错误LNK1120:1未解析的外部文件在使用VS2010之前必须在VS2010中重建该项目。现在可以工作了。

必须在VS2010中重建项目,然后才能使用它。现在工作